A.M. Best Affirms Rating of Connaught Insurance Company

OLDWICK, N.J.--(BUSINESS WIRE)--July 14, 2003--A.M. Best Co. has affirmed the financial strength rating of B+ (Very Good) of Connaught Insurance Company Limited, the Guernsey-based single parent captive of Thomas Greg & Sons de Colombia S.A. The outlook is stable.

The rating reflects the company's solid operating performance, strong risk-based capitalisation, high levels of liquidity and cash flow and sound risk management practices. In addition, the rating recognises Connaught's integral role in facilitating the trading operations of its parent, Thomas Greg & Sons Limited (TG&S).

Offsetting rating factors include the company's concentration on one predominant line of business, its status as a single parent captive, its size (surplus was USD 5.6 million at year-end 2002) and very substantial reliance upon reinsurance protection. The rating also reflects the volatility implicit in the type of business written both in terms of underlying risk and the availability and pricing of open market coverage, which has been evident in a much higher loss ratio for 2002, increased retentions and significantly increased reinsurance costs for 2003.

Expectations:

-- A.M. Best expects Connaught to continue to underwrite to an
aggregate retention level that is consistent with its current
rating level and to maintain a strong risk-adjusted capital
position.

-- A.M. Best does not foresee any material changes in Connaught's
income stream or overall expense levels.
